The Armoury in Clockwork Castle gradually fills up with interesting objects as the player completes quests in Skyrim. I usually refer to this as the "museum system". People occasionally ask me for a list of these items and the events that trigger them, so I thought I'd write an article on it.

These may be considered spoilers, so be sure you're okay with that before reading any further.

Most of the items that appear as part of the museum system are presented as replicas of the typically unique, only-one-of-its-kind items they represent, as this made more sense to me. And to address a related frequently asked question; unique items (e.g. Daedric artefacts) that are also weapons or armour are not represented in the museum system because they can be displayed on the normal mounts/mannequins in the Armoury, like any other weapon/piece of armour.

All objects (barring certain things like faction banners) have accompanying plaques that explain the objects and what events prompted them. I won't reproduce all that text - just list the objects and which quests/events triggered them.

Objects in the museum system appear in two main areas; the Armoury Hall (with the staircase) and the "Museum Area" around behind the staircase on the ground floor. Additionally there's a small secret vault adjoining the museum area. (It's behind the "fake" wardrobe.)

Starting with the hall:


Armoury Hall

Dragon skull
- Defeating Alduin.

Heraldic shields
- Becoming Thane of a Hold in Skyrim; one for each Hold.
- Plaques for these shields are located on the balustrade at the top of the stairs, across from the wall the shields are mounted on.

Legion banners
- Joining the Imperial Legion.

Stormcloak banners
- Joining the Stormcloaks.

Jorrvaskr banners
- Joining the Companions.

College of Winterhold banners
- Joining the College of Winterhold.

Dawnguard banners
- Joining the Dawnguard.


Museum Area

Dragonstone reproduction
- Recovering the Dragonstone from Bleak Falls Barrow.

Frieze from High Hrothgar
- Recognised as Dragonborn by the Greybeards.

Horn of Jurgen Windcaller replica
- Recovering the Horn of Jurgen Windcaller.

Frieze from Sky Haven Temple
- Finding Alduin's Wall in Sky Haven Temple.

Elder Scroll "Dragon" replica
- Recovered "Dragon" Elder Scroll from Blackreach.

Elder Scroll "Sun" replica
- Recovered "Sun" Elder Scroll from Dimhollow Crypt.

Elder Scroll "Blood" replica
- Recovered "Blood" Elder Scroll from Soul Cairn.

Jagged Crown reproduction
- Recovered the Jagged Crown.

Imperial Legion device in wrought iron
- Helped take Windhelm for the Legion.

Stormcloak device in stone
- Helped take Solitude for the Stormcloaks.

Statue of Ysgramor
- Becoming Harbinger of the Companions.

Saarthal Amulet replica
- Reported findings in Saarthal to the Arch-Mage.

Inert magical conduit
- Meeting the Augur of Dunlain beneath the College of Winterhold.

Emblem of the College of Winterhold in stone
- Becoming Arch-Mage.

Necromancer Amulet replica
- Resolving "Blood on the Ice" quest.

"Calcelmo's Stone" charcoal rubbing
- Translating Gallus' journal and discovering Mercer's motivations.

Crown of Barenziah replica
- Restored Crown of Barenziah.

Skeleton Key replica
- Recovered the Skeleton Key.

Azura's Star replica
- Cleansed Azura's Star.

Black Star replica
- Completed the Black Star.

Oghma Infinium (artist's impression)
- Discovered Oghma Infinium.

Ring of Hircine replica
- Receiving the Ring of Hircine.

Namira's Ring replica
- Receiving Namira's Ring.

Statuette of Dibella in silver
- Rescued the Sybil of Dibella.

Dwemer Lexicon replica
- Returned Dwemer Lexicon to Avanchnzel.

White Phial replica
- Repaired the White Phial.

Reproduction of Potema's Skull
- Defeat Wolf Queen Potema.

Reproduction of the Crescent Moon Crest found in Castle Volkihar.
- Entered the Soul Cairn.

Soul Cairn gravestone
- Returned from Soul Cairn with the "Blood" Elder Scroll.

Initiate's Ewer
- Defeated Arch-Curate Vyrthur in the Forgotten Vale.

Ornate blood potion bottle
- Defeat Lord Harkon.

Aetherium Crest replica
- Used the Aetherium Forge.

Dunmer-style lantern
- Arrived on Solstheim in search of Miraak.

Chisel from Solstheim
- Cleansed the All-Maker stones of Miraak's corruption.

Dwemer Control Cube replica
- Found Black Book in Nchardak.

Tome from Apocrypha
- Defeat Miraak.

Small chunk of Stalhrim
- Learnt to craft items out of Stahlrim.

Small piece of heart stone
- Delivered a heart stone to Neloth.

Ash Extractor tool
- Delivered ash spawn sample to Neloth.

Replica of decorated skull found in Kolbjorn barrow
- Discover decorated skull in Kolbjorn barrow, continue excavation.

Skull of a frost giant
- Defeat Karstaag.

Treasure map of Solstheim
- Defeat the ghost of Haknir Death-Brand.


Secret Vault

Dark Brotherhood banner and tenets
- Joining the Dark Brotherhood.

Thieves Guild banner
- Joining the Thieves Guild.

Nightingales banner
- Joining the Nightingales.

Bust of the Gray Fox in stone
- Becoming Guildmaster of the Thieves Guild.

Werewolf Drum Totem
- Joining The Circle.

Wedding Dress
- Assassinate Vittoria Vici at her wedding.

Device from the Katariah, in wood with gold plating
- Assassinate the Emperor.

Bloodstone Chalice replica
- Filled and returned the Bloodstone Chalice.

      Each item or set of items has an xmarker as an enable parent, and the xmarker has a script attached that runs when you enter the Armoury cell, checking to see if a particular stage of a particular quest has been done. If so, the xmarker is enabled (along with its child item/s).

      I did my best with selecting appropriate quests and quest stages to check, but some of the quests can be pretty complex and I certainly don't know all their inner workings inside and out. Maybe some can be completed in a way that wouldn't set the stage I'm checking? Maybe other mods could change which stages are set, too.

      And maybe I just straight-up checked the wrong stage in some cases, and no-one's noticed/reported it? That's less likely considering how long the mod's been out and how many people have played it, but it's still possible.
